The attached proposed Resolution has been prepared in order
to provide compensation, in the amount of $18,000.00, for special
counsel to the Code Enforcement Board for Fiscal Year '97-98.
Funds are available from Account No. 820101.
The use of special counsel to serve as the legal advisor to
the Code Enforcement Board is required because the City Attorney
prosecutes code violations before the Board. It is impermissible
for the City Attorney to serve as the legal advisor to the Code
Enforcement Board while prosecuting code violations before the
same.
